Transaction 22868774e681c91d336729fb3ce120e46b56f93739fec4a4e311c8ae9e1e2f79

1 Input
2 Outputs
  • 22868774e681c91d336729fb3ce120e46b56f93739fec4a4e311c8ae9e1e2f79:0
  • value  2133729584
    address  1HC1U8dEJ62oLBX7sVa9idruiiGYTUXsmh
  • 22868774e681c91d336729fb3ce120e46b56f93739fec4a4e311c8ae9e1e2f79:1
  • value  4917016581
    address  15qg1gw6nWjrfURtKw627Qapfk5mgoDmJo